- We offer all available effective treatment options for asthma. The following treatments are available from our office:
- Rescue mediations like Albuterol, Xopenex, Combivent, Atrovent and Maxair
- Controller medications
- Inhaled steroids- Flovent, Qvar, Asthmanex, Pulmicort
- Non steroids- Singulair, Zyflo
- Combination therapy- Symbicort, Advair
- Infusion therapy- Xolair
- Injection therapy- Allergen immunotherapy
